Wie kann ich den Listenstil von Bootstrap anpassen?
Der Listenstil von Bootstrap kann durch benutzerdefinierte CSS -Klassen angepasst werden. Zu den grundlegenden Klassen gehören: ungeordnete Listen (
), geordnete Listen (
) und Inline-Listen (
). Durch Hinzufügen von benutzerdefinierten Klassen können Sie den Listenstil ändern, z. B. Markierungen, Hinzufügen von Farben, Symbolen und Abstand. Zu den erweiterten Tipps gehört die Verwendung des: N-Child () -Sektors zur Implementierung von Farbverfärbungen miteinander und die Verwendung von SASS oder weniger Präprozessoren zur Vereinfachung des Codes. Behalten Sie beim Anpassen die Stilkonsistenz bei und vermeiden Sie eine Überkunden.
Wie kann ich den Listenstil von Bootstrap anpassen?
Sie müssen sich fragen, dass der Listenstil von Bootstrap ausreicht. Warum müssen Sie ihn anpassen? Das ist richtig, Bootstrap bietet grundlegende Listenstile, die einfach und praktisch sind. Wenn Ihr Design jedoch etwas Einzigartiges benötigt oder wenn Ihr Projekt besondere Anforderungen an Stil hat, wird die Anpassung zu einem Muss. In diesem Artikel werden Sie in die Anpassung von Bootstrap -Listenstilen übernommen, von Grundkenntnissen bis hin zu erweiterten Techniken, mit der Sie problemlos mit Bootstrap -Listen navigieren und einzigartige visuelle Effekte erstellen können.
Lassen Sie uns zunächst kurz die Listentypen von Bootstrap überprüfen: nicht ordnungsgemäße Liste <ul></ul>
, bestellte Liste <ol></ol>
und Inline-Liste <ul class="list-inline"></ul>
. Dies sind die Grundlagen von Bootstrap, und alle unsere Anpassungen basieren darauf.
Bootstrap verwendet CSS -Klassen, um den Stil der Liste zu steuern. Beispielsweise entfernt .list-unstyled
das Tag vor dem Listenelement, .list-inline
ordnet das Listenelement in einer Zeile angeordnet. Das Verständnis dieser integrierten Klassen ist die Grundlage für die Anpassung.
Beginnen wir mit einem einfachen Beispiel. Nehmen wir an, Sie möchten eine ungeordnete Liste mit benutzerdefinierten Farben und Symbolen erstellen:
<code class="html"><ul class="my-custom-list"> <li> <i class="fas fa-check"></i> Item 1</li> <li> <i class="fas fa-times"></i> Item 2</li> <li> <i class="fas fa-exclamation"></i> Item 3</li> </ul></code>
<code class="css">.my-custom-list { list-style: none; /* 去除默认的项目标记*/ padding-left: 20px; /* 添加内边距*/ } .my-custom-list li { color: #3498db; /* 自定义颜色*/ margin-bottom: 10px; /* 添加项目间的间距*/ } .my-custom-list li i { margin-right: 5px; /* 图标与文字间的间距*/ color: #e74c3c; /* 自定义图标颜色*/ }</code>
In diesem Code erstellen wir eine benutzerdefinierte Klasse .my-custom-list
und verwenden sie, um den Stil der Liste zu steuern. Wir haben das Standard -Projekt -Markup entfernt, Margen und Abstand zwischen Elementen und angepassten Text- und Symbolfarben hinzugefügt. Die Schriftart der Schriftart der Schriftart wird hier verwendet, und Sie können sie durch die Symbolbibliothek ersetzen, die Ihnen gefällt. Denken Sie daran, dies ist nur ein einfaches Beispiel. Sie können mehr Stile hinzufügen, wie Sie möchten.
Wenn Sie weiterhin die Listenelemente über unterschiedliche Hintergrundfarben oder sogar ansprechende Layouts haben, müssen Sie fortgeschrittenere CSS-Techniken wie Pseudoklasse-Selektoren verwenden :nth-child()
, Medienfragen usw.
Beispielsweise kann die Verwendung :nth-child()
die Farbverzerrung erzielen:
<code class="css">.my-custom-list li:nth-child(even) { background-color: #f0f0f0; }</code>
Natürlich können Sie Präprozessoren wie SASS oder weniger verwenden, um Ihre CSS zu verwalten, wodurch Ihr Code prägnanter und einfacher zu warten ist. Denken Sie daran, dass die Auswahl des richtigen Tools Ihre Effizienz erheblich verbessern kann.
Schließlich ist ein wichtiger Punkt: Nicht zu überkunden. Nur durch die Aufrechterhaltung der Konsistenz von Stilen und die Koordinierung mit dem Gesamtstilstil-Stil können wir eine schöne und benutzerfreundliche Benutzeroberfläche erstellen. Zu viel Anpassung kann zu Verwirrung zu Styling führen und die Wartungsschwierigkeiten erhöhen. Überlegen Sie sich vor dem Anpassen sorgfältig über Ihre Bedürfnisse und wählen Sie die am besten geeignete Methode. Dies ist der wahre Weg, um ein großer Stier zu sein.
Das obige ist der detaillierte Inhalt vonWie kann ich den Listenstil von Bootstrap anpassen?. Für weitere Informationen folgen Sie bitte anderen verwandten Artikeln auf der PHP chinesischen Website!

Bootstrap ist ein Front-End-Framework, das von Twitter entwickelt wurde und HTML, CSS und JavaScript integriert, um Entwicklern dabei zu helfen, reaktionsschnelle Websites schnell aufzubauen. Zu den Kernfunktionen gehören: Grid-System und Layout: Basierend auf dem 12-Spalte-Design, mithilfe von Flexbox-Layout und der Unterstützung reaktionsschneller Seiten verschiedener Gerätegrößen. Komponenten und Stile: Stellen Sie eine reichhaltige Komponentenbibliothek wie Schaltflächen, Modalboxen usw. an, und Sie können schöne Effekte erzielen, indem Sie Klassennamen hinzufügen. Wie es funktioniert: Verlassen Sie sich auf CSS und JavaScript, CSS verwendet weniger oder SASS -Präprozessoren, und JavaScript beruht auf JQuery, um interaktive und dynamische Effekte zu erzielen. Durch diese Funktionen verbessert Bootstrap die Entwicklung erheblich

BootstrapisafreecssframeworkThatSImplifieswebdevelopmentByProvidingPre-StyledComponentsandjavaScriptplugins.

Bootstrapisafree, Open-SourcecsSframeworkthathelpscreberesesive, Mobile-firstwebsites.1) ITOFFERSAGRIDSYSTEMForLayoutflexibilität) einschließlich der KomponentsForquickDesign und 3) iShighlycustoBableToavoidGenericlooklooks, stellyrequectoppingcustobrigingcustoppingcustobrigeln

Bootstrap eignet sich für schnelle Konstruktion und kleine Projekte, während React für komplexe und interaktive Anwendungen geeignet ist. 1) Bootstrap bietet vordefinierte CSS- und JavaScript -Komponenten, um die Entwicklung der reaktionsschnellen Schnittstelle zu vereinfachen. 2) React verbessert Leistung und Interaktivität durch Komponentenentwicklung und virtuelles DOM.

Der Hauptzweck von Bootstrap besteht darin, Entwicklern dabei zu helfen, schnell reaktionsschnelle, mobile Websites aufzubauen. Zu den Kernfunktionen gehören: 1. Responsive Design, das Layoutanpassungen verschiedener Geräte durch ein Gittersystem realisiert; 2. Vordefinierte Komponenten wie Navigationsbalken und Modalboxen sorgen für Ästhetik und Cross-Browser-Kompatibilität; 3. Unterstützen Sie die Anpassungen und Erweiterungen und verwenden Sie SASS -Variablen und Mixins, um Stile anzupassen.

Bootstrap ist besser als Rückenwindcss, Foundation und Bulma, da es einfach zu bedienen ist und schnell reaktionsschnelle Websites entwickelt. 1.Bootstrap bietet eine reichhaltige Bibliothek mit vordefinierten Stilen und Komponenten. 2. Die CSS- und JavaScript -Bibliotheken unterstützen reaktionsschnelle Design- und interaktive Funktionen. 3. für schnelle Entwicklung geeignet, aber benutzerdefinierte Stile können komplizierter sein.

Das Integrieren von Bootstrap in React -Projekte kann auf zwei Arten durchgeführt werden: 1) Einführung mit CDN, geeignet für kleine Projekte oder schnelle Prototypen; 2) Installation mit dem NPM -Paketmanager, geeignet für Szenarien, die eine tiefe Anpassung erfordern. Mit diesen Methoden können Sie schnell schöne und reaktionsschnelle Benutzeroberflächen in React erstellen.

Zu den Vorteilen der Integration von Bootstrap in React -Projekte gehören: 1) schnelle Entwicklung, 2) Konsistenz und Wartbarkeit und 3) reaktionsschnelles Design. Durch direkte Einführung von CSS-Dateien oder die Verwendung der React-Bootstrap-Bibliothek können Sie die Komponenten und Stile von Bootstrap in Ihrem React-Projekt effizient verwenden.


Heiße KI -Werkzeuge

Undresser.AI Undress
KI-gestützte App zum Erstellen realistischer Aktfotos

AI Clothes Remover
Online-KI-Tool zum Entfernen von Kleidung aus Fotos.

Undress AI Tool
Ausziehbilder kostenlos

Clothoff.io
KI-Kleiderentferner

Video Face Swap
Tauschen Sie Gesichter in jedem Video mühelos mit unserem völlig kostenlosen KI-Gesichtstausch-Tool aus!

Heißer Artikel

Heiße Werkzeuge

EditPlus chinesische Crack-Version
Geringe Größe, Syntaxhervorhebung, unterstützt keine Code-Eingabeaufforderungsfunktion

ZendStudio 13.5.1 Mac
Leistungsstarke integrierte PHP-Entwicklungsumgebung

DVWA
Damn Vulnerable Web App (DVWA) ist eine PHP/MySQL-Webanwendung, die sehr anfällig ist. Seine Hauptziele bestehen darin, Sicherheitsexperten dabei zu helfen, ihre Fähigkeiten und Tools in einem rechtlichen Umfeld zu testen, Webentwicklern dabei zu helfen, den Prozess der Sicherung von Webanwendungen besser zu verstehen, und Lehrern/Schülern dabei zu helfen, in einer Unterrichtsumgebung Webanwendungen zu lehren/lernen Sicherheit. Das Ziel von DVWA besteht darin, einige der häufigsten Web-Schwachstellen über eine einfache und unkomplizierte Benutzeroberfläche mit unterschiedlichen Schwierigkeitsgraden zu üben. Bitte beachten Sie, dass diese Software

MantisBT
Mantis ist ein einfach zu implementierendes webbasiertes Tool zur Fehlerverfolgung, das die Fehlerverfolgung von Produkten unterstützen soll. Es erfordert PHP, MySQL und einen Webserver. Schauen Sie sich unsere Demo- und Hosting-Services an.

mPDF
mPDF ist eine PHP-Bibliothek, die PDF-Dateien aus UTF-8-codiertem HTML generieren kann. Der ursprüngliche Autor, Ian Back, hat mPDF geschrieben, um PDF-Dateien „on the fly“ von seiner Website auszugeben und verschiedene Sprachen zu verarbeiten. Es ist langsamer und erzeugt bei der Verwendung von Unicode-Schriftarten größere Dateien als Originalskripte wie HTML2FPDF, unterstützt aber CSS-Stile usw. und verfügt über viele Verbesserungen. Unterstützt fast alle Sprachen, einschließlich RTL (Arabisch und Hebräisch) und CJK (Chinesisch, Japanisch und Koreanisch). Unterstützt verschachtelte Elemente auf Blockebene (wie P, DIV),